Arlington Village, VA is a charming neighborhood located in Arlington County just a few miles outside of Washington, D.C. With a population of approximately 19,000 residents, this small village boasts a diverse community filled with young professionals, families, and retirees. The neighborhood is known for its tree-lined streets, historic architecture, and vibrant atmosphere.
The climate in Arlington Village is typical of the Mid-Atlantic region, with hot and humid summers and cold winters. The neighborhood experiences all four seasons, making it an ideal location for those who enjoy outdoor activities year-round. Arlington Village is also known for its beautiful parks, green spaces, and proximity to the Potomac River, providing residents with plenty of opportunities to enjoy nature.
Key historical facts about Arlington Village include its origins as a planned community in the early 20th century, with many of the homes dating back to that time period. The neighborhood has a rich history, with many buildings and landmarks that have been preserved and maintained over the years. Cultural highlights in Arlington Village include a variety of shops, restaurants, and cafes that cater to residents' diverse tastes and preferences.
